WHAT DOES RANDLORD M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Randlord

Randlords were the entrepreneurs who controlled the diamond and gold mining industries in South Africa in its pioneer phase from the 1870s up to World War I. A small number of European adventurers and financiers, largely of the same generation, gained control of the diamond mining industry at Kimberley, Northern Cape. They set up an infrastructure of financing and industrial consolidation which they then applied to exploit the discoveries of gold from 1886 in Transvaal at Witwatersrand — the "Rand". Once based in the Transvaal many set up residence in the mansions of Parktown. Many of the Randlords received baronetcies from Queen Victoria in recognition of their contributions.

Definition of randlord in the English dictionary

The definition of randlord in the dictionary is a mining magnate during the 19th-century gold boom in Johannesburg.
